Mission RRIC Join our Rapid Response & Intermediate Care service expanding across Buckinghamshire. Work across Intermediate Care and Community Physiotherapy within the Buckingham Team. Watch our RRIC team talk about their roles – and why you should join them: https://careers.buckshealthcare.nhs.uk/rric Your mission and aim Provide expert interventions and rehabilitation as part of a dynamic, tight‑knit team that reacts quickly when people are in crisis. Help patients stay in their own home, empowering recovery and preventing unnecessary hospitalisation. Support early discharge from hospital and patients at the end of life. Who we are We are part of Buckinghamshire Healthcare NHS Trust, based in 7 locations across the county, including two Urgent Community Response Squads. Together we operate as one mission force, collaborating with colleagues across all sectors of health and social care. Who you are If you are committed to excellence, motivated to develop your clinical skills, driven by being at the cutting edge of healthcare delivery and thrive as part of a team – choose #MissionRRIC today. Main duties Provide triage, comprehensive specialist assessment, review and evaluation of patients and carers. Plan programmes of care to promote health gain and maximise independence, actively case‑manage patients through their journeys. Allocate appropriate workloads to members of the Rapid Response & Intermediate Care (RRIC) team. Work with a range of professionals to ensure care is appropriate and delivered in a timely manner. Demonstrate professional skills and competence in leadership, care planning/coordination, and care and treatment delivery. Support the development of clinical pathways. Work across Intermediate Care and Community Physiotherapy pathways.
